1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is Newton's 2nd Law of Motion?
Back
The force applied = the object's mass times the acceleration; F=ma.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does a Free Body Diagram (FBD) represent?
Back
A diagram showing all the forces acting on an object.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is centripetal acceleration?
Back
The change in velocity of an object traveling in a circular path.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
According to Newton's First Law of Motion, how long will an object remain at rest?
Back
Until an unbalanced force occurs.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the definition of unbalanced forces?
Back
Forces that cause a change in the motion of an object.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does inertia refer to in physics?
Back
The tendency of an object to resist a change in its state of motion.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the formula for calculating force?
Back
Force = mass x acceleration (F=ma).
